THE choice in affordable 4-dr Hatchbacks
I had been looking at used '94-98 VW Golfs for a Hatchback before I realized Kia started making one in 2000. Lacking refinement compared to a Honda or Toyota, but has an excellent 4-Door Hatchback layout, and for the price, it's good enough.
long term info
bought new 2000. never had warranty repair. only recommended servicing. 32 m.p.g. a blast to drive. still looks like new. bought Sportage in 2001 same reliability. best you can get for the money.
Don't Buy any Kia
As soon as I drove it off the lot, my troubles began. I have returned this car 8 times for repair. Mainly because of cheap materials. I still have to take it back for 3 more repairs. Most recently the dashboard came unglued, sounds like there is a screw rattling around in the steering wheel, and the paint is peeling. My nightmare continues. I only get 22 MPG. Do yourself a favor and don't buy one.
